In nearly all cases, a two year old cat has reached full body size: Maine Coon cats may continue to "fill out" for some months after this.

Knowledge of when your cat is fully grown to its potential size is also crucial when nourishing, exercising, and even treating it medically while it is still young. As I've mentioned before, cats do not vary in size as drastically as dogs do, so you can expect most cats to be around 6-12 pounds when they grow up

According to the American Animal Hospital Association, 12 months old is the age when most kittens are fully grown 1.At this age, your kitty then enters the next life. The short answer is: most cats stop growing in height and length around 12 months of age, however, they may continue to fill out until they are about 18 months old
